Mexican President Lopez Abrader has ordered another 4,000 troops to provide security for state-owned pipeline facilities, reports the Mexico News Daily.
The troops will join the 4,000 soldiers and marines already stationed to guard the six main Pemex pipelines, which stretch nearly 995 miles (1,600 km), Obrador said on Jan. 10.
Surveillance bases will also be set up along the pipeline network from which the military will carry out anti-fuel theft operations, the president said.
